Finally, the title hints at the broader ecology of digital media. Filenames like "ARMD-972.mp4" proliferate across cloud drives, institutional servers, and personal devices. They are artifacts of a technical infrastructure that organizes contemporary memory. Yet as archives scale, reliance on opaque identifiers can sever connections between material and meaning. Archivists now emphasize rich metadata—descriptive tags, provenance notes, and contextual narratives—to restore interpretive depth. A single filename, then, is both an index entry and an incomplete story; it beckons for curatorial labor to surface its contextual layers.
